A New Look and Feel for a Gaming Phone — Asus ROG Phone 9 Pro
The Asus ROG Phone 9 Pro is a gaming phone that does not scream 'gamer' from every angle. Its design is a subtle evolution from last year’s model, with a relatively discrete shape that makes it more comfortable to carry and use daily. The rear houses an upgraded AniMe Vision system with many more LEDs, adding a playful touch that can even run simple games using the mappable Air Trigger controls. While this is a fun extra, its true value comes from the phone's improved practicality for everyday life.
This generation keeps the IP68 water resistance and wireless charging from its predecessor, features that are still rare among gaming-focused phones. The box is packed with accessories, and the phone itself feels substantial at 227 grams. For pure gaming ergonomics, some may still miss dual front-facing speakers, but the overall build quality is excellent, using Gorilla Glass Victus 2 for durability. The Phantom Black color keeps things understated, allowing the powerful hardware to speak for itself.
Snapdragon 8 Elite: Raw Power for Every Task — Asus ROG Phone 9 Pro
At the heart of the ROG Phone 9 Pro is Qualcomm's Snapdragon 8 Elite chipset. This upgrade is not just about higher benchmark scores; it addresses a key issue from the previous generation: sustained performance. The phone stays consistently fast during long gaming sessions, thanks to an improved passive cooling system. This means no throttling when you need raw performance the most—whether you are playing the latest titles or multitasking between demanding apps.
With 16GB to 24GB of RAM and storage options up to 1TB, the phone handles anything you throw at it. A second USB-C port on the left edge lets you charge while gaming in market mode, a thoughtful touch for serious players. The attachable AeroActive Cooler X Pro (included with the Pro Edition) provides a few percent more performance if you need every bit of power. This combination of chipset, cooling, and memory makes the phone a leader in raw speed.
A Display That Keeps Up with the Action — Asus ROG Phone 9 Pro
The 6.78-inch LTPO AMOLED display is a highlight, with a refresh rate that can reach up to 185Hz. This ensures buttery-smooth motion in compatible games and scrolling through the interface. The screen is bright and colorful, making it a joy for both gaming and watching videos. However, hardcore gamers may note the hole-punch camera, which partially obstructs the screen, a compromise not found on some competitors.
Battery life is where this phone truly shines. The 5,800mAh cell provides the best endurance reviewers reported in a phone, letting you enjoy serious gaming on your commute without worrying about running out of power. Charging is fast at 65W wired, and it also supports 15W wireless charging. The phone ships with Android 15, and Asus promises five years of security updates, though only two major OS upgrades. While the camera system—a 50MP main, 13MP ultrawide, and 32MP 3x telephoto—is adequate, the sensors are small, leading to average low-light performance.
This keeps the phone from being a perfect mainstream flagship, but for those who prioritize speed and stamina, it is an excellent daily driver.

Battery Life That Lasts All Day and Beyond
The Asus ROG Phone 9 Pro is a standout when it comes to endurance. With its large 5,800mAh battery, this phone offers some of the best battery life reviewers reported in a smartphone. It easily lasts through a full day of heavy use, and for many people, it will comfortably stretch into a second day. This makes it a great choice for anyone who is tired of constantly charging their phone, whether they are a gamer or not.
When it is time to top up, the phone supports fast 65W wired charging, which gets you back to full quickly. There is also 15W wireless charging, a feature that is still rare on gaming phones but very welcome for everyday convenience. While the Asus ROG Phone 9 Pro excels in many areas, its camera system is a clear compromise. The phone has a 50MP main camera, a 13MP ultrawide lens, and a 32MP 3x telephoto camera. In daylight, the main camera can take decent photos with accurate colors. However, the camera sensors are small compared to those in dedicated flagship phones. This is especially noticeable in low-light situations, where images can look noisy and lack detail.
The ultrawide and telephoto cameras also perform adequately in bright conditions but struggle when the lights go down. For everyday social media snaps, the camera is perfectly fine. But if photography is a top priority for you, you will likely be happier with a more camera-focused flagship. Who is the ROG Phone 9 Pro best for?
The ROG Phone 9 Pro is best for someone who wants sustained gaming, controls, and high refresh rates. Its 227g weight is the clearest compromise if pocket comfort and one-handed use matter.
What software support does the ROG Phone 9 Pro have?
The recorded Asus support commitment for the ROG Phone 9 Pro is two OS upgrades and five years of security updates. That period begins near the original release date, not when a used phone changes owners, and rollout timing can vary by region or carrier.
